Breastfeeding and Weight Loss
Celebrities like Christina Aguilera have spoken openly about how breastfeeding helped them lose weight after giving birth. Studies show that breastfeeding can help burn hundreds of extra calories each day in the months following birth. But breastfeeding alone is unlikely to give typical new moms the kind of results achieved by stars like Naomi Watts, Jessica Alba, and Nelly Furtado - all proponents of breastfeeding as a post-pregnancy weight loss method.
Most celebs (including Christina Aguilera) combine breastfeeding with intense workout sessions and diets heavy on protein, greens, and other healthy foods packed with nutrients. So while celebrity moms sometimes give the impression that breastfeeding alone is responsible for their dramatic weight loss, it is most likely the combination of breastfeeding, healthy eating, and regular exercise that is helping these stars get back in top shape in a matter of weeks.
Bouncing Back through Exercise
Celebrity moms are able to regain their slim physiques quickly after giving birth in part because they are usually extremely fit before they conceive. They also tend to exercise throughout their pregnancies, some right up until their 35th week. This gives them a leg up on new moms who may be transitioning into a new exercise routine after giving birth rather than easing back into an established routine.
Celebrities also jack up their exercise routines into high gear in the months after giving birth. While the typical new mom might be able to squeeze in workouts every other day (and that's probably being generous given the hectic schedules of new moms), celeb moms like Kate Hudson, Heidi Klum, and Jessica Alba reportedly worked with a trainer an hour a day, six days a week after giving birth. New mom Jennifer Lopez even had a new gym built in her house during her pregnancy and began intense workouts with her trainer as soon as her doctor gave her the go ahead.
Celebrity Diet Secrets Revealed
Celebrity post-pregnancy diets run the gamut from strict low-carb, high-protein plans to a 30-day detox. These diets are designed to achieve quick results, but leave little flexibility for new moms on the go.
Post-pregnancy diet staples for stars like Cate Blanchett, Heidi Klum, Jessica Alba, and Christina Aguilera include everything from brown rice to grilled chicken, steamed vegetables, and green tea. Alba, who was back to her pre-pregnancy body just two months after giving birth, reportedly took in just 1,700 calories a day to shed her pregnancy pounds quickly, burning up to 600 calories with daily workout routines. Another celeb diet shortcut: Jennifer Lopez, who dropped a whopping 40 pounds in the months after the birth of her twins, relied on an all-natural food delivery service to supply her with four small meals a day.
